Solve by completing the square a^2 + 10a+21=0

a^2 + 10a + 21 = 0
a^2 + 10a = -21
a^2 + 10a + 25 = -21 + 25
(a + 5)^2  = 4
sqrt (a+5)^2 = sqrt 4
a + 5 = (+-) 2
a = -5 (+-) 2

a = -5 + 2 = -3
a = -5 - 2 = -7

solution is : a = -3 and a = -7 <==
